Output 28b63a909c9bb3187426303213a24fc337955bda123f153ece9114d6e7bb375a:0

value
15076653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ac4189ac22fea367d42121f930feca591d27b26 OP_EQUAL
address
373k2fchnVr52hK9VC3heFDRsRq82Yjj8W
transaction
28b63a909c9bb3187426303213a24fc337955bda123f153ece9114d6e7bb375a
spent
true